More About The Sprinter Van
The Mercedes-Benz Sprinter van seats up to 14 passengers and sits in the sweet spot between a standard SUV and a full-size minibus — roomy enough for a real group, compact enough to navigate San Francisco's notoriously narrow streets, tight parking garages, and congested downtown drop zones without the headaches a 35-foot bus would create. That maneuverability matters in a city where Market Street bus lanes, the Civic Center one-ways, and loading zones around Moscone Center all have their own rules for oversized vehicles. For airport runs to San Francisco International Airport (SFO) (San Francisco, CA 94128) or Oakland International, a Sprinter van handles luggage for the whole group without the group splitting into separate cars.
It's the right fit for 8–14 passengers who want a shared, comfortable ride without coordinating a convoy.

How much does a Sprinter Van cost in San Francisco?
Sprinter van rentals in San Francisco run roughly $200–$275 per hour on weekdays and $225–$375 per hour on weekends, with full-day rates typically landing between $1,400 and $2,750. Weekend pricing reflects higher demand — Giants home games at Oracle Park, winery tours up Highway 29, and Saturday wedding shuttles through Pacific Heights all pull from the same pool of available vehicles, so rates move with the calendar. The date, total trip hours, pickup location, and the specific vehicle all shift the final number.
